
redis
名字不用写
这个作者很懒,什么都没留下…
展开
-
Redis 常见的性能问题和解决方法
参考网站:http://blog.nosqlfan.com/html/4077.html本文来自温柔一刀的分享,介绍了他在实际工作中遇到的一些Redis问题以及对应的规避和解决方案,如果你也在用Redis,那么可能其中有一些经验可供参考。原文链接:http://zhupan.iteye.com/blog/15761081.Master写内存快照save命令调度rdbSave函数转载 2017-09-22 16:10:49 · 2508 阅读 · 0 评论 -
为什么Redis内存不宜过大
这几年的线上业务表明,redis这个内存数据库,它的高性能、稳定性都是不用怀疑的,但我们塞进redis的数据过多,内存过大,那如果出问题,那它可能会带给我们的就是灾难性(我想很多公司都遇到过) 这里列举一下,我们遇到的一些问题:1 主库宕机先来看一下主库宕机容灾过程:如下图在主库宕机的时候,我们最常见的容灾策略为“切主”。具体为从该集群剩余从库中选出一个从库并将转载 2017-09-22 11:24:09 · 353 阅读 · 0 评论 -
redis内存使用优化-Redis key设计的一些学问
一、背景: 选择合适的使用场景 很多时候Redis被误解并乱用了,造成的Redis印象:耗内存、价格成本很高: 1. 为了“赶时髦”或者对于Mysql的“误解”在一个并发量很低的系统使用Redis,将原来放在Mysql数据全部放在Redis中。 ----(Redis比较适用于高并发系统,如果是一些复杂Mis系统,用Redis反而麻烦,因为单从功能讲Mysql要更为强大,转载 2017-09-22 13:31:31 · 1678 阅读 · 0 评论 -
redis-bgrewriteaof问题--持久化恢复问题
一、背景1. AOF: Redis的AOF机制有点类似于Mysql binlog,是Redis的提供的一种持久化方式(另一种是RDB),它会将所有的写命令按照一定频率(no, always, every seconds)写入到日志文件中,当Redis停机重启后恢复数据库。 2. AOF重写: (1) 随着AOF文件越来越大,里转载 2017-09-22 13:42:07 · 670 阅读 · 0 评论 -
Redis关键点(自动bgrewriteaof)
Redis 2.4版本做了很多功能改进,尤其是aof这块变动较大。增加了自动的bgrewriteaof,开启两个后台线程来避免主线程fsync、rename、close等阻塞操作,另外修复了出现重复命令进入aof文件的bug,下面是基于2.4.1的源码aof这块的改进分析。旧的版本问题主要有:1 主线程aof的每次fsync(everysecond模式)在高并发下时常出现100ms转载 2017-09-22 14:00:28 · 654 阅读 · 0 评论 -
有关linux下redis overcommit_memory的问题
背景 公司的redis有时background save db不成功,通过log发现下面的告警,很可能由它引起的:[13223] 17 Mar 13:18:02.207 # WARNING overcommit_memory is set to 0! Background save may fail under low memory condition. To fix thi转载 2017-09-22 14:16:02 · 386 阅读 · 0 评论 -
redis 配置 参数 详解
redis 配置 参数 详解张映 发表于 2015-04-30分类目录: nosql标签:nosql, redis, 参数, 配置redis配置参数,非常的多,下面罗列了一些redis 常用参数配置,以及中文注释。查看复制打印?/********************************* GENERAL转载 2017-09-22 14:25:05 · 383 阅读 · 0 评论 -
redis持久化 RDB 和 AOF对比 redis容灾备份
1.redis持久化 RDB 和 AOF对比 以及实现细节2.redis容灾备份具体参见 http://www.redis.cn/topics/persistence.html转载 2017-09-22 15:01:37 · 335 阅读 · 0 评论 -
全面解析redis cluster
全面剖析Redis Cluster原理和应用1.Redis Cluster总览1.1 设计原则和初衷在官方文档Cluster Spec中,作者详细介绍了Redis集群为什么要设计成现在的样子。最核心的目标有三个:性能:这是Redis赖以生存的看家本领,增加集群功能后当然不能对性能产生太大影响,所以Redis采取了P2P而非Proxy方式、异步复制、客户端重定向等设计,而牺牲转载 2017-10-31 18:40:35 · 2217 阅读 · 0 评论